Studying engineering at the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(HKUST) has been an exciting and rewarding journey, where my creativity, problem-solving abilities, and capacity for innovation are continually nurtured and challenged. HKUST, with its diverse community, enriched by students from various backgrounds, has given me the opportunity to connect with individuals who share their unique backgrounds and personal stories. These connections have allowed me to broaden my view of the world, while fostering innovative ideas and teamwork among each other. Thanks to the availability of innovative facilities, such as the ECE MakerSpace, I have been able to transform my ideas into practical and executable projects, gaining hands-on experience that bridges the gap between theory and practice.
The academic challenges I faced at HKUST have pushed me beyond my limits, driving personal growth in an unanticipated manner. Tackling complex engineering problems has not only sharpened my problem-solving abilities but also sparked a deep curiosity to identify and bridge gaps in my knowledge. These experiences have also strengthened my friendships, as collaborating closely with peers has fostered bonds that extend far beyond the classroom.
My experience at HKUST has been so much more than simply pursuing an education. It has also been a life-changing journey filled with opportunities for self-discovery, meaningful connections, and lifelong friendships. As an Engineering Student Ambassador (ESA), I have had the opportunity to mentor and motivate incoming and prospective students to embark on their own unforgettable journeys. It will be a privilege to share my transformative experiences, helping future freshmen feel more welcomed into our vibrant community.
